Of course, there were several others, as well. When he shot Bill Clinton for Esquire towards the end of Clinton&#8217;s Presidency, Platon told Clinton, &#8220;Show me the love!&#8221; Clinton&#8217;s advisers frantically attempted to tell him to not show Platon anything. The President responded, &#8220;Shut up. Shut up. I know what he&#8217;s talking about,&#8221; before delivering the pose that landed on the cover of Esquire. When P.Diddy arrived at Platon&#8217;s studio, he told him to cut the Miles Davis record that Platon had on the stereo and put in one of Diddy&#8217;s own records. Vladimir Putin is a huge Beatles fan. The three things that Michael Bloomberg said he could not do without on a desert island are &#8220;Salma Hayek. Salma Hayek.
